In this tutorial from BrightSpark Engineering Channel, we dive deep into the fundamental conversions of complex numbers—a crucial skill for electrical engineering, physics, and advanced mathematics. We break down the step-by-step process of moving between the Rectangular Form (x + jy) and the Polar Form (r\angle\theta). Whether you are solving AC circuit problems or preparing for engineering exams, mastering these conversions is essential for simplifying multiplications, divisions, and power calculations. What you will learn in this video: How to calculate the magnitude (r) and phase angle (\theta) from rectangular coordinates. The technique to convert polar coordinates back into real and imaginary components. Common pitfalls with quadrant signs and how to avoid them using the tan^{-1} function. Solved practice problems to solidify your understanding.
